Doubts Persist That Our Decisions Come from Above: Chairman of the RTRC
Edita
Doubts have arisen regarding the independence of the Television and Radio Commission, with suggestions that decisions may, to some extent, come from above. This was stated today during a press conference by Tigran Hakobyan, the Chairman of the Television and Radio Commission.
“It is clear—whether you believe it or not is your right—but we make decisions independently. No organization in Armenia has ever predetermined our decisions or work. Of course, there have been attempts, and recently those attempts have diminished because everyone understands that, first, it is not effective, and second, it contradicts the values that our commission seeks to adopt,” Hakobyan noted.
